Curso – Taller de Analítica en Grafos
 

Docentes: Vanina Beraudo, Néstor Coppolillo y Eduargo Poggi.
 
Fecha de inicio: 14 de Junio de 2021
 
Descripción: 
La Analítica en Grafos como subdisciplina de Minería de Datos ha incrementado su valor en los últimos tiempos acompañando el crecimiento de análisis de redes sociales. Sin embargo, su utilización y potencial puede aplicarse en una gran variedad de temáticas. El estudio de los grafos tiene una trayectoria importante que combinada con la potencialidad de las herramientas propias de la minería puede ofrecer resultados sumamente interesantes.

Temario: 
  • Conceptos básicos de grafos: indicadores de relación; patrones en grafos; búsquedas en grafos; implementación de bases de persistencia orientadas a grafos.
  • Aplicación de indicadores de relaciones en prácticas de minería de datos: gracias a la generación de indicadores de relación a partir de una representación de entidades en una base de grafos enriquecer las prácticas tradicionales de minería de datos.
  • Aplicación de nuevas técnicas de Minería de Grafos para diversos problemas como  segmentación y reconocimiento de patrones en diversas temáticas como, por ejemplo: lenguaje natural, redes sociales, detección de relaciones particulares en diferentes negocios, etc. 

No se incluye en el temario: 

  • Técnicas de modelado de grafos.
  • Técnicas de uso de base de datos orientadas a grafos como medio de persistencia de sistemas transaccionales.

=== Aim & Scope ===

The international summer school VISMAC “VISione delle MACchine” (in
English, “Machine Vision”) is organized every two years by the
“Associazione Italiana per la ricerca in Computer Vision, Pattern
recognition e machine Learning” (CVPL – ex-GIRPR) affiliated to
International Association for Pattern Recognition (IAPR). It represents
a stimulating opportunity for doctoral students, young researchers from
universities, research institutions and industry. The primary objective
of the Summer School is to provide a common scientific and cultural
background on the subjects of computer vision and pattern recognition.

This edition of VISMAC will mainly focus on four renowned research
topics: Bio-imaging, Automotive, Cultural Heritage, Image forensics.

The amount of data generated nowadays by society, city infrastructures, and digital technologies around us is astonishing. The analysis, modeling and knowledge extraction of/from these data is a key asset for understanding urban environments and improving the efficiency of urban mobility,  air quality and other forms of sustainability. This special session provides a platform to share high-quality research ideas related to data science methods and technologies for urban environments, a topic of crucial importance for many Sustainable Development Goals (i.e., SDG 7 on Sustainable Energy and SDG 11 on Sustainable Cities and Communities). Another important goal is to establish a meeting point for researchers in academia and industry who develop methodologies and technologies for data science, machine learning and artificial intelligence with specific applications in smart and sustainable cities.
